ISLAMABAD (Web Desk) - The federal government has agreed to fulfill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f’s (PTI) five demands including recount in disputed constituencies, electoral reforms, formation of new election commission and action against those involved in election rigging, Dunya News reported on Tuesday.

According to sources, the government has acknowledged its willingness to all the politicians and opposition leaders.

The government has insisted that ‘power’ could only be changed within the constitutional ambit.

It is pertinent to mention here that government’s decision regarding fulfillment of demands was also discussed in a meeting chaired by leader of the opposition Khurshid Shah.

The move came a day after PTI chief Imran Khan announced to lead thousands of marchers towards Islamabad  red zone , in a bid to force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if to resign and hold re-election.
